How To Write Resume For Ceiler
- Highlight your technical skills and experience in BIM software, such as Revit and Navisworks.
- Quantify your accomplishments with specific metrics, such as percentage improvements or cost savings.
- Showcase your ability to work independently and as part of a team.
- Emphasize your commitment to continuous learning and professional development.
- Tailor your resume to each job you apply for, highlighting the skills and experience that are most relevant to the position.
